tutoriels:ressources:mathgraph:exercice_matrices_1
Différences
Ci-dessous, les différences entre deux révisions de la page.
|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
| tutoriels:ressources:mathgraph:exercice_matrices_1 [23/01/2024 10:44] – ybiton | tutoriels:ressources:mathgraph:exercice_matrices_1 [05/11/2025 18:21] (Version actuelle) – modification externe 127.0.0.1 | ||
|---|---|---|---|
| Ligne 1: | Ligne 1: | ||
| + | ====== Produit matriciel ====== | ||
| + | |||
| + | |||
| Nous désirons créer une ressource de calcul proposant un calcul matriciel | Nous désirons créer une ressource de calcul proposant un calcul matriciel | ||
| - | Pour créer cette ressource vous devez utiliser | + | Pour créer cette ressource vous pouvez |
| Si nécessaire, | Si nécessaire, | ||
| Ligne 7: | Ligne 10: | ||
| ==== Etape 1 : Création de la figure MathGraph ==== | ==== Etape 1 : Création de la figure MathGraph ==== | ||
| - | Commencez par [[tutoriels: | + | Commencez par [[figure_mathgraph|créer la figure mathgraph]]. |
| Si vous désirez sauter ce qui suit vous pouvez utiliser le code Base 64 de la figure ci-dessous et, dans MathGraph32, | Si vous désirez sauter ce qui suit vous pouvez utiliser le code Base 64 de la figure ci-dessous et, dans MathGraph32, | ||
| Ligne 14: | Ligne 17: | ||
| </ | </ | ||
| - | Nous vous proposons de télécharger ci-dessous une bibliothèque de macro constructions qui vont nous simplifier un peu la tâche. Cliquez sur le line ci-dessous pour télécharger le fichier zip, et décompressez le dans le dossier de votre choix. Les fichiers contenant des macro constructions MathGraph32 ont le suffixe //mgc//. | + | Nous vous proposons de télécharger ci-dessous une bibliothèque de macro constructions qui vont nous simplifier un peu la tâche. Cliquez sur le lien ci-dessous pour télécharger le fichier zip, et décompressez le dans le dossier de votre choix. Les fichiers contenant des macro constructions MathGraph32 ont le suffixe //mgc//. |
| + | |||
| + | {{ : | ||
| Une fois le logiciel démarré, cliquez sur l' | Une fois le logiciel démarré, cliquez sur l' | ||
| - | Incorporons dans notre figure | + | Incorporons dans notre figure deux macro constructions |
| Pour pouvoir utiliser ces macro construction dans MathGraph32, | Pour pouvoir utiliser ces macro construction dans MathGraph32, | ||
| Ligne 24: | Ligne 29: | ||
| Cliquez ensuite sur l' | Cliquez ensuite sur l' | ||
| - | Allez dans le dossier où vous avez décompressé le fichier zip contenant | + | Allez dans le dossier où vous avez décompressé le fichier zip contenant |
| - | Procédez de même pour incorporer dans la figure la macro contruction | + | Procédez de même pour incorporer dans la figure la macro construction |
| Ces deux constructions font maintenant partie de votre figure. | Ces deux constructions font maintenant partie de votre figure. | ||
| Ligne 36: | Ligne 41: | ||
| Cliquez ensuite sur l' | Cliquez ensuite sur l' | ||
| - | Dans la boîte de dialogue qui s' | + | Dans la boîte de dialogue qui s' |
| Une nouvelle boîte de dialogue s' | Une nouvelle boîte de dialogue s' | ||
| Ligne 54: | Ligne 59: | ||
| Mais nous devons modifier certains de ces calculs pour les adapter à la situation prévue. | Mais nous devons modifier certains de ces calculs pour les adapter à la situation prévue. | ||
| - | Ces calculs étant des objets finaux de macro constructions, | + | Ces calculs étant des objets finaux de macro constructions, |
| Il y a une solution à cela : les transformer en des objets normaux. | Il y a une solution à cela : les transformer en des objets normaux. | ||
| Ligne 75: | Ligne 80: | ||
| |nbcas10|prov|4| | |nbcas10|prov|4| | ||
| - | Vous pouvez maintenant sélectionner le calcul nommé prov et cliquer sur le bouton **Supprimer**. Si un message vous avertit que d' | + | La macro a aussi créé des calculs |
| Utilisez maintenant l' | Utilisez maintenant l' | ||
| Ligne 102: | Ligne 107: | ||
| Utilisez l' | Utilisez l' | ||
| - | Cette fois sélectionnez la construction nommée Preparation3Etapes et cliquez sur le bouton **Implémenter**. | + | Cette fois sélectionnez la construction nommée |
| - | Cette construction n'a pas besoin d'objet source. Si vous cliquez sur l' | + | Comme précédemment, |
| + | un calcul nbEtapes1 qui ne servira pas ici car nous avons déjà créé un calcul nommé nbEtapes. Ce calcul contient comme formule 3+0*prov. Vous pouvez supprimer ce calcul ici inutile. | ||
| - | Elle a aussi ajouté à la figure 3 macros | + | Vous pouvez maintenant sélectionner le calcul nommé prov et cliquer sur le bouton **Supprimer**. Si un message vous avertit que d'autres objets seront supprimés, c'est que vous avez oublié de modifier une des formules ci-dessus ou que vous n'avez pas supprimé le calcul nbEtapes1. |
| - | Nous allons maintenant créer un affichage LaTeX destiné | + | Elle a aussi ajouté |
| - | Pour cela, déroulez | + | Pour pouvoir modifier ces objets il faut à nouveau cliquer sur l' |
| + | |||
| + | Normalement, après l' | ||
| + | |||
| + | La macro construction a créé pour vous un affichage LaTeX de tag //enonce1// que vous voyez sur la figure. Son contenue actuel est le suivant : | ||
| + | |||
| + | < | ||
| + | \begin{array}{l} | ||
| + | \text{Première ligne de l' | ||
| + | \\ \text{Deuxième ligne de l' | ||
| + | \end{array} | ||
| + | </ | ||
| + | |||
| + | Cliquez sur l' | ||
| {{: | {{: | ||
| Ligne 163: | Ligne 182: | ||
| * cas4 : matrice 3 x 3 à gauche, matrice ligne x y z à droite (n' | * cas4 : matrice 3 x 3 à gauche, matrice ligne x y z à droite (n' | ||
| - | Pourquoi | + | Une remarque : Pourquoi |
| Il s'agit d'une astuce : quand la variable etape ne vaudra plus 1, cet affichage LaTeX aura un angle avec l' | Il s'agit d'une astuce : quand la variable etape ne vaudra plus 1, cet affichage LaTeX aura un angle avec l' | ||
| - | Pour que cet affichage LaTeX soit reconnu | + | La macro construction a aussi affecté un tag //enonce1// à cet affichage LaTeX. Cela permettra à laboMep de le reconnaître |
| - | Pour cela, dans la barre supérieure, | + | Il nous faut modifier |
| - | En bas de la liste, sélectionnez le dernier objet qui est notre affichage LaTeX puis cliquez sur le bouton changer le tag pour lui affecter comme tag la chaîne de caractères // | + | Utilisez l' |
| - | Il nous faut maintenant créer un affichage LaTeX destiné | + | Cliquez |
| - | Cliquez | + | Le code actuel est : |
| - | + | < | |
| - | Remplissez la boîte de dialogue comme ci-dessous en n' | + | \text{Entrer ici le formulaire |
| + | </code> | ||
| {{: | {{: | ||
| - | Voici ci-dessous le code LaTeX à utiliser : | + | Voici ci-dessous le nouveau |
| < | < | ||
| \text{Réponse : list1} | \text{Réponse : list1} | ||
| </ | </ | ||
| - | |||
| - | Pour que cet affichage LaTeX soit reconnu comme formulaire, il faut lui affecter le tag formulaire1. | ||
| - | |||
| - | Comme précédemment, | ||
| Ce formulaire ne contiendra qu'une seule liste déroulante, | Ce formulaire ne contiendra qu'une seule liste déroulante, | ||
| Ligne 196: | Ligne 212: | ||
| Utilisez de nouveau l' | Utilisez de nouveau l' | ||
| - | Remplissez la boîte de dialogue comme ci-dessous | + | Remplissez la boîte de dialogue comme ci-dessous,avec la formule 0/(etape=1) dans le champ **Angle**. Utiliser cette formule dans le champ **Angle** n'est pas indispensable mais fera disparaître cet affichage LaTeX quand nous préparerons les étapes suivantes. |
| {{: | {{: | ||
| Ligne 210: | Ligne 226: | ||
| Le contenu de chaque \text de ce code fournit un item de la liste (donc ici les items OUI et NON). | Le contenu de chaque \text de ce code fournit un item de la liste (donc ici les items OUI et NON). | ||
| - | Procédez de même que précédemment pour affecter | + | Nous devons lui affecter le tag //list11// (le premier chiffre 1 car on est à l' |
| Nous devons aussi fournir un calcul donnant la bonne réponse pour cette liste. | Nous devons aussi fournir un calcul donnant la bonne réponse pour cette liste. | ||
| Ligne 227: | Ligne 243: | ||
| Exécuter cette macro a donné à la variable //etape// la valeur 2 et, ainsi, les affichages LaTeX précédents ont disparu (ils n' | Exécuter cette macro a donné à la variable //etape// la valeur 2 et, ainsi, les affichages LaTeX précédents ont disparu (ils n' | ||
| - | Nous allons maintenant créer l'affichage | + | D'autres affichages |
| - | Utilisez l' | + | Dans l' |
| + | |||
| + | Utilisez l' | ||
| Voici le code LaTeX à utiliser. C'est le même que le précédent à l' | Voici le code LaTeX à utiliser. C'est le même que le précédent à l' | ||
| Ligne 275: | Ligne 293: | ||
| </ | </ | ||
| - | Utilisez | + | Il nous faut maintenant modifier le formulaire à l'étape2 qui a été créé par la macro construction. |
| - | Il nous faut maintenant fournir le formulaire à l'étape2. | + | Déplacez |
| - | + | ||
| - | Cliquez à nouveau sur l'icône | + | |
| - | + | ||
| - | N' | + | |
| < | < | ||
| \text{Le résultat est une matrice à edit1 lignes et edit2 colonnes} | \text{Le résultat est une matrice à edit1 lignes et edit2 colonnes} | ||
| </ | </ | ||
| - | |||
| - | Utilisez l' | ||
| Ce formulaire comportera donc deux éditeurs de formule (on est en mode texte) repérés dans le code LaTeX par //edit1// et //edit2//. | Ce formulaire comportera donc deux éditeurs de formule (on est en mode texte) repérés dans le code LaTeX par //edit1// et //edit2//. | ||
| Ligne 303: | Ligne 315: | ||
| Il faut maintenant nous attaquer à l' | Il faut maintenant nous attaquer à l' | ||
| - | Activez l' | + | Activez l' |
| - | Cliquez | + | Sont apparus deux nouveaux affichages LaTeX destinés |
| + | |||
| + | Procédez de même que précédemment pour changer leur code LaTeX en utilisant | ||
| + | |||
| + | Voici le code LaTeX pour l'énoncé à l'étape | ||
| < | < | ||
| Ligne 315: | Ligne 331: | ||
| </ | </ | ||
| - | Utilisez l' | ||
| - | |||
| - | Créons maintenant l' | ||
| - | |||
| - | Utilisez l' | ||
| - | Voici le code LaTeX utilisé (il reprend une bonne partie du code LaTeX du premier énoncé) : | + | Voici le code LaTeX utilisé |
| < | < | ||
| Ligne 380: | Ligne 391: | ||
| \end{array} | \end{array} | ||
| </ | </ | ||
| - | |||
| - | Utilisez l' | ||
| Quelques explications concernant ce code LaTeX : | Quelques explications concernant ce code LaTeX : | ||
| Ligne 415: | Ligne 424: | ||
| {{: | {{: | ||
| - | Une fois la première | + | Une fois la première |
| ^Nom de la fonction de x, y et z^Formule^Commentaire^ | ^Nom de la fonction de x, y et z^Formule^Commentaire^ | ||
| Ligne 474: | Ligne 483: | ||
| Il nous reste à fournir un affichage LaTeX qui fournira la solution de l' | Il nous reste à fournir un affichage LaTeX qui fournira la solution de l' | ||
| - | Utilisez | + | Cet affichage LaTeX est présent sur la figure depuis le début. S'il est masque par des affichages LaTex d' |
| + | |||
| + | Son code LaTeX provisoire est : | ||
| + | < | ||
| + | \begin{array}{l} | ||
| + | \text{Première ligne de la solution} | ||
| + | \\ \text{Deuxième ligne de la solution} | ||
| + | \end{array} | ||
| + | </ | ||
| + | |||
| + | Mais depuis sa création lors de l' | ||
| + | |||
| + | Utilisez | ||
| + | |||
| + | Remplacez son code LaTeX par le par le code LaTeX suivant : | ||
| < | < | ||
| Ligne 572: | Ligne 595: | ||
| \end{array} | \end{array} | ||
| </ | </ | ||
| - | |||
| - | Il reste à utiliser l' | ||
| La figure est prête. Il est conseillé de l' | La figure est prête. Il est conseillé de l' | ||
| - | ==== Etape 2 : Création de notre ressource dans LaboMep | + | Il est inutile ici de cacher nos affichages LaTeX donnant les énoncés, formulaires et autres et les macros permettant de changer d' |
| + | |||
| + | ==== Etape 2 : Création de notre ressource dans LaboMep ==== | ||
| - | Connectez vous à LaboMep | + | Connectez vous à LaboMep avec votre identifiant et votre mot de passe : https:// |
| A droite, déroulez Mes Ressources, et faites un clic droit sur un dossier contenu dans Mes Ressources. Dans l’exemple ci-dessous, il s’agit du dossier Test. Si vous n’avez pas de dossier dans Mes Ressources, vous devez en créer un (en cliquant droit sur l’icône avec un dossier et un signe + vert). | A droite, déroulez Mes Ressources, et faites un clic droit sur un dossier contenu dans Mes Ressources. Dans l’exemple ci-dessous, il s’agit du dossier Test. Si vous n’avez pas de dossier dans Mes Ressources, vous devez en créer un (en cliquant droit sur l’icône avec un dossier et un signe + vert). | ||
tutoriels/ressources/mathgraph/exercice_matrices_1.1706003085.txt.gz · Dernière modification : de ybiton